THE SALIENCY GROUPING FIELD (TP-P8)
Author(s) :
Maurizio Pilu (HP Labs, UK)
Abstract : A saliency map specifies the relevance of locations in an image and good methods exist today for recovering it automatically in a bottom-up fashion. This paper addresses the problem of finding organization in a actual saliency map of everyday images trough a grouping field in order to elicit structure that can be used for a variety of purposes. After calculating the saliency using a version of the Itti and Koch model, we retain only the maxima of the map as features. Then we calculate an initial grouping field by convolving the salient location with the orientation-selective grouping kernels. Finally we iteratively reinforce the field to enhance perceptually salient components.
